diff --git a/tests/test_downloadermiddleware_httpcache.py b/tests/test_downloadermiddleware_httpcache.py index f5917d0f06d..972d400a499 100644 --- a/tests/test_downloadermiddleware_httpcache.py +++ b/tests/test_downloadermiddleware_httpcache.py @@ -155,13 +155,13 @@ def _get_settings(self, **new_settings): new_settings.setdefault('HTTPCACHE_GZIP', True) return super(FilesystemStorageTest, self)._get_settings(**new_settings) + class LeveldbStorageTest(DefaultStorageTest): try: pytest.importorskip('leveldb') except SystemError: - # Happens in python 3.8 - pytestmark = pytest.mark.skip("'SystemError: bad call flags' occurs on Python 3.8") + pytestmark = pytest.mark.skip("Test module skipped - 'SystemError: bad call flags' occurs when >= Python 3.8") storage_class = 'scrapy.extensions.httpcache.LeveldbCacheStorage'